Abstract: | In classical investigations of panel flutter it is usually assumed that the gas pressure acting on the plate can be calculated within the framework of the piston theory, an approximation exact for high Mach numbers. The loss of stability revealed in these investigations is of the “coupled” type, involving the interaction of two oscillation modes. Recently, the use of asymptotic methods revealed another single-mode type of stability loss, which cannot be obtained within the framework of the piston theory. In the present study this type of stability loss is investigated numerically using the Bubnov-Galerkin method. |
